High security at Uddhav Thackeray home!

A warning by two Maharashtra leaders – Member of Legislative Assembly (MLA) Ravi Rana and his wife independent Member of Parliament (MP) Navneet Rana – has prompted the Mumbai Police to tighten the security outside chief minister Uddhav Thackeray’s Bandra home – Matoshree. Last week, Ravi Rana had threatened to chant “Hanuman Chalisa” outside the CM’s home.

“Uddhav Saheb has forgotten Hindutva, the ideology on which he sought votes and got seats (for his party). He has forgotten the teachings of Balasaheb. So, we will recite Hanuman Chalisa outside Matoshree at 9 am on Saturday to remind the CM of Balasaheb’s teachings. We will go peacefully and will not cause any inconvenience to Mumbaikars,” he had told reporters.
